Output d89d760a856216edbaf67cb521a93fc4504f188537ec2bb56522fea1cd8f57bb:1

value
24543
script pubkey
OP_0 OP_PUSHBYTES_20 ab66c18a62dcc4aa13e75025453e9c23801fefc2
address
bc1q4dnvrznzmnz25yl82qj5205uywqplm7zyd5kvd
transaction
d89d760a856216edbaf67cb521a93fc4504f188537ec2bb56522fea1cd8f57bb
confirmations
154145
spent
true